概要
APIリファレンス
指定された定期購買IDの詳細情報を取得する。
項目名 | 内容 |
---|---|
アクション名 | getSubscription |
リクエストメソッド | POST |
項目名 | 内容 | 必須 | 入力例 | 備考 |
---|---|---|---|---|
subscriptionId | 定期購買ID | はい | gid://shopify/SubscriptionContract/123456789 |
指定された定期購買IDの詳細情報を返却されます。
■正常時レスポンス
プロパティ | 型 | 説明 |
---|---|---|
subscriptionContractId | string | 契約情報のShopify管理ID |
isSyncingSubscription | boolean | 定期購買契約データ同期中判別フラグ |
createdAt | timestamp | 契約作成日(UTC) |
contractType | string | 契約種別 |
status | string | 契約情報のステータス |
nextBillingDate | timestamp | 次回決済日時(UTC) |
nextDeliveryDate | timestamp | 次回お届け日(UTC) |
deliveryDays | number | 契約情報のお届けまでに必要な日数 |
deliveryTime | string | null |
deliveryTimeText | string | お届け日時間帯 |
billingPolicyInterval | string | 契約情報の決済周期(単位) |
billingPolicyIntervalCount | number | 契約情報の決済周期 |
billingPolicyMinCycles | number | null |
billingPolicyMaxCycles | number | null |
deliveryCountry | string | null |
deliveryCountryCode | string | null |
deliveryProvince | string | null |
deliveryProvinceCode | string | null |
deliveryZip | string | null |
deliveryCity | string | null |
deliveryAddress1 | string | null |
deliveryAddress2 | string | null |
deliveryFirstName | string | null |
deliveryLastName | string | null |
※ メタフィールドを商品に設定した場合によって、返却されるレスポンスが異なります。
(1)メタフィールドにhuckleberry_subscription.Include_filter(含むフィルター)を商品に設定した場合
(2)メタフィールドにhuckleberry_subscription.exclude_filter(除外フィルター)を商品に設定した場合
(3)メタフィールドにhuckleberry_subscription.category(カテゴリー)を商品に設定した場合
(4)メタフィールドにhuckleberry_subscription.Include_filter_modal_title(含むフィルタータイトル)を商品に設定した場合